Universal Express Announces Agreement with Transaction Management, LLC

Innovative New Bill Payment Services Platform to be offered through Universal Post Division

FORT WORTH – June 7, 2004 – Universal Express, Inc. (OTCBB:USXP) and Transaction Management, LLC (TMLLC), - The electronic age has been bridged by a new electronic bill payment service now offered through Universal Post, a division of Universal Express, and is being offered throughout their association member stores, nationwide. The service developed and marketed for Vista Bank, Ralls, Texas is EmpaSys’ “Pay All Bills Here” and provides “one-stop” convenience for anyone needing to pay any bill.

An estimated 25 million U.S. wage earners who operate without checking accounts represent a market in need of a solution. Now, a bill payer can take that bill or statement to a participating store, become an established “Pay All Bills Here” customer and pay any bill. The entire process is completed at one convenient location. The “Pay All Bills Here” system is a nationwide; Internet based solution and allows electronic payments to more than 2500 billers nationwide, with new billers being added weekly. However, unlike similar services, billers can be paid even if they are not supported as an electronic biller. “Pay All Bills Here” facilitates the transfer of funds from a cash paying customer to a biller or creditor conveniently and securely.

About Transaction Management, LLC

Founded in February 2003, the entire team at TMLLC operates with nearly sixty years of combined experience in the technology and electronic payments industries. EmpaSys “Pay All Bills Here”, developed by and marketed for Vista Bank, Ralls, Texas has become the industry's choice for collecting electronic bill payments. At present, TMLLC markets services through its channel partners and referral agents for electronic commercial banking and bill payment solutions. These services, along with the many other electronic payment processes that the company provides, enhance merchant's ability to increase their walk-in traffic, increase their revenues, and accept payments anytime, anywhere and in any fashion.
